I accidentally locked my 1996 jeep
grand Cherokee laredo's glovebox. It is
now stuck open. It wont close. Im using
tape to keep it kinda closed. I have to
use tape to keep the light off. How do I
unlock it so I can close it .

2 Answers

44,360

While pulling on the latch release, take a screwdriver and flip open the locking hasp on the inside part of the latch. You'll see it sort of open up to receive the other half the latch. That's what it does when the glove box opens normally. Tinker with it and you will figure it out.
